Hawks Claim Home Opener Against Point

Hawks Claim Home Opener Against Point

Montgomery, Alabama – The Hawks soared past the Skyhawks in their season/home opener with a score of 25-9.

With an 8-3 first quarter the Hawks claimed control in their home opener. Scoring in the first three minutes, senior midfielder Ryan Campion set the pace for the Hawks. However, in the next two minutes Point scored three goals to claim the lead (3-1). Campion stepped back up and scored again to bring the Hawks within one. The remaining five minutes of the first quarter was all Hawks after freshman Gage Kettlewell made his debut scoring three of the Hawks six points in the remaining time (8-3). In the second quarter Huntingdon continued to dominate and score. Senior attack and leading scorer for the night Ian Bruggeman tallied four goals and Kettlewell tagged in to score two more goals as the Hawks shut out the Skyhawks heading into halftime with a score of 17-3.

 

Point looked to regain some ground early in the third quarter as they scored two goals in the first four minutes of the half (17-5). Huntingdon refused to let up and scored four more goals in the third quarter to tie the quarter score 4-4 and have a game score of 21-7 heading into the final quarter. The Hawks outscored Point 4-2 in the fourth with Bruggeman setting a new career high by scoring his 6th goal of the night. Alexander Hero also claimed a new career high with his 3rd goal in the fourth quarter to help lift the Hawks to their win.

 

Stat Leaders for Huntingdon:

#32 Ian Bruggeman – 6 Goals

#12 Gage Kettlewell – 5 Goals

#6 Alexander Hero – 3 Goals

#3 Caden Bacz – 3 Goals
